美文网首页kubernetesk8sjs css html
kubernetes的资源管理概述

kubernetes的资源管理概述

作者: 只吃十二分饱 | 来源:发表于2022-09-20 19:31 被阅读0次

    在kubernetes中,所有的内容都抽象为资源,用户需要通过操作资源来管理kubernetes。

    kubernetes的本质上就是一个集群系统,用户可以在集群中部署各种服务,所谓的部署服务,其实就是在kubernetes集群中运行一个个的容器,并将指定的程序跑在容器中。

    kubernetes的最小管理单元是pod而不是容器,所以只能将容器放在Pod中,而kubernetes一般也不会直接管理Pod,而是通过Pod控制器来管理Pod的。

    Pod可以提供服务之后,就要考虑如何访问Pod中服务,kubernetes提供了Service资源实现这个功能。

    当然,如果Pod中程序的数据需要持久化,kubernetes还提供了各种存储系统。

对图片的解释:

pod控制器的作用是产生很多pod,pod中运行容器,容器中运行程序。

如果程序需要数据存储的话,那么就会有很多数据存储卷(volume),其中configmap、pvc、secret是为了存储数据中的资源。

pod要想外部进行访问,kubernetes提供了service代理。外部通过访问service就能访问pod了。

相关文章

  • kubernetes的资源管理概述

    在kubernetes中,所有的内容都抽象为资源,用户需要通过操作资源来管理kubernetes。 kub...

  • k8s-资源管理(四)

    本章节主要介绍yaml语法和kubernetes的资源管理方式 1.资源管理介绍 在kubernetes中,所有的...

  • kubernetes(三) 资源管理

    资源管理介绍 在kubernetes中,所有的内容都抽象为资源,用户需要通过操作资源来管理kubernetes。 ...

  • kubernetes 概述

    一、kubernetes 概述 1、kubernetes 基本介绍 kubernetes,简称 K8s,是用 8 ...

  • kubernetes概述

    一:Docker与k8s简介 在正式开始分享之前,给大家先分享一个相关的小故事:老王的叩问 老王是一家公司的工程师...

  • Kubernetes概述

    摘自:https://www.kubernetes.org.cn/k8s 简介 Kubernetes是一个开源的,...

  • Kubernetes概述

    Kubernetes 是一个可移植的、可扩展的开源平台,用于管理容器化的工作负载和服务,可促进声明式配置和自动化。...

  • Kubernetes概述

     K8S是基于容器的集群管理平台,它的全称,是Kubernetes 。Kubernetes 是一个可移植的、可扩展...

  • Kubernetes Dashboard

    概述 Kubernetes Dashboard 是 Kubernetes 集群的 Web UI,用于管理集群。 安...

  • Kubernetes 简介

    Kubernetes 简介 概述 Kubernetes 是 Google 2014 年创建管理的,是 Google...

网友评论

    本文标题:kubernetes的资源管理概述

    本文链接:https://www.haomeiwen.com/subject/yiqwnrtx.html